Tailored for Success: Best Practices in Custom Dating App Development

In the ever-changing world of dating applications, custom development has emerged as an important hit technique. Tailoring your dating app to your target audience’s specific requirements and tastes can dramatically improve the user experience, engagement, and, ultimately, success of your app. In this complete tutorial, we’ll look at the best practices for custom dating app development, from market research to design and technical execution.

Understanding the Market

Before going into development, it is important to undertake extensive market research. Analyze your target audience’s demographics, tastes, and behaviors. Understanding what users want in a dating app, their frustrations with current platforms, and future trends can provide essential ideas for designing your app.

Key Considerations

  • Demographics: Determine the age range, gender distribution, location preferences, and other demographic characteristics of your target audience.
  • Preferences: Discover user preferences for matchmaking algorithms, communication features, profile customization options, and privacy settings.
  • Behavioral Insights: Examine user habits such as swiping patterns, messaging frequency, app usage, and retention rates.

Defining Unique Features

Determine the distinguishing aspects of your own dating app based on market research findings. To provide a compelling user experience, these features should be tailored to user preferences and solve specific problems.

Innovative Features to Consider:

  • Advanced Matchmaking Algorithms: Create advanced algorithms that leverage user preferences, behavior analysis, compatibility measures, and machine learning to provide individualized matchmaking.
  • Interactive Profiles: Users can construct rich profiles that express their individuality with multimedia content, interactive components, and storytelling features.
  • Real-time Interaction: Use real-time texting, video calls, and voice chats to ensure seamless communication and meaningful interactions.
  • Safety and Privacy: Integrate strong security measures, verification processes, anonymity choices, and content control tools to create a safe dating environment.
  • Social Integration: Use social media integration, event sharing, group activities, and community elements to improve social interactions and participation. 

User-Centric Design

In order to draw in and keep users, your custom dating app’s design is essential. Concentrate on developing an interface that is easy to use, aesthetically pleasing, and intuitive in order to improve accessibility and encourage exploration.

Design Principles to Follow:

  • Simplicity: Adopt a design that is clear, uncluttered, and emphasizes the most important elements.
  • Personalization: Customize themes, color schemes, font sizes, and layout options to accommodate a range of user preferences.
  • Accessibility: Make sure that features like text contrast, screen reader compatibility, and font readability are accessible to people with disabilities.
  • Responsive Design: Create an application with responsive design so that it works seamlessly on PCs, tablets, and smartphones of all sizes and shapes. 

Technical Implementation

Technical knowledge of backend infrastructure, databases, APIs, cloud services, and mobile app development are necessary for the creation of specialized dating apps. Work together with seasoned designers, developers, and QA testers to guarantee seamless functioning and execution.

Technical Components

  • Frontend Development: For cross-platform compatibility and native-like performance, choose contemporary frameworks like React Native, Flutter, or Swift.
  • Backend Infrastructure: To manage user data, matchmaking algorithms, and real-time communication, set up scalable and secure server architecture using tools like Node.js, Python, or Ruby on Rails.
  • Database Management: For keeping user profiles, preferences, communications, and media assets, pick dependable databases like MongoDB, PostgreSQL, or Firebase.
  • API Integration: Use third-party APIs to incorporate social media integration, payment gateways, analytics tracking, and geolocation services.
  • Cloud Services: For hosting, scalability, data backup, and security compliance, make use of cloud platforms such as AWS, Azure, or Google Cloud. 

Testing and Iteration

To find and fix any flaws, performance problems, or usability difficulties, testing is an essential step. To guarantee compatibility and dependability, thoroughly test across a variety of devices, operating systems, and network configurations.

Testing Processes

  • Functionality Testing: Verify each and every aspect of the app, such as chat, media uploads, matching algorithms, profile creation, registration, and alerts.
  • Performance Testing: Assess the speed, responsiveness, resource usage, and scalability of an application under various load conditions.
  • Security Testing: To safeguard user information and privacy, conduct security audits, penetration tests, data encryption checks, and compliance evaluations.
  • Usability Testing: Evaluate overall usability, navigation flow, intuitiveness, and user satisfaction by gathering feedback from user groups and beta testers. 

Launch and Marketing Strategy

To effectively promote your bespoke dating app when development and testing are over, concentrate on a well-thought-out launch and marketing strategy. To reach your target audience and encourage app downloads, make use of influencer relationships, digital marketing platforms, app store optimization (ASO), and user acquisition efforts.

Marketing Tactics

  • App Store Optimization (ASO): Improve your app’s descriptions, screenshots, metadata, and keywords to increase its visibility and ranking in app stores.
  • Social Media Promotion: Share success stories, execute targeted marketing campaigns, generate buzz, and interact with consumers using social media platforms.
  • Influencer Partnerships: Partner with bloggers, industry insiders, and influencers to expand your app’s reach, establish your brand, and create buzz.
  • Content marketing: To highlight the features, advantages, and success stories of your app, provide interesting and educational content like blogs, videos, infographics, and user testimonials.
  • Programs for User Referrals: Encourage user referrals, retention, and engagement by using gamification elements, loyalty awards, and referral incentives. 

Continuous Improvement and Adaptation

The process of creating a personalized dating app doesn’t finish with release. To find chances for new features, places for improvement, and ways to react to changing customer needs, keep an eye on industry trends, analytics data, and user input.

Strategies for Continuous Improvement

  • Iterative Updates: Based on user input and data analysis, release updates on a frequent basis that include bug repairs, performance improvements, feature enhancements, and user-requested additions.
  • A/B testing: To maximize conversion rates and user engagement, test different UI/UX designs, feature implementations, pricing schemes, and marketing campaigns.
  • Data-driven Decisions: Make advantage of analytics tools for churn prediction, cohort segmentation, retention analysis, and user behavior analysis.
  • Competitor Analysis: To remain inventive and competitive, keep up with industry advancements, market changes, and rival strategies. 

Conclusion

The creation of a custom dating app demands a calculated strategy, knowledge of the market, cutting-edge features, user-centered design, technological prowess, rigorous testing, successful marketing, and ongoing development. You can develop a customized and profitable dating app that connects with users, helps them make lasting connections, and stands out in the crowded market by adhering to best practices and utilizing technological advances.

Reset Password
Compare items
  • Total (0)
Compare
0
Shopping cart